How patients opt in
Patients opt in to SMS communication at the time they book or confirm an appointment with a participating Practice. The Practice presents the patient with an intake form (online or in-office) that includes the following checkbox, which the patient must affirmatively check to consent:
☐ I agree to receive appointment-related text messages from my dental practice and IvoryStack, including appointment confirmations, reminders, and short video messages from my provider. Standard message and data rates may apply. Message frequency: 1–4 messages per appointment. I understand I can opt out at any time by replying STOP.
Patients may decline this checkbox without affecting their ability to book or attend an appointment.
Types of messages patients receive
Opted-in patients may receive:
- A welcome message when a new appointment is booked, including a short video message from the provider.
- An appointment reminder the morning of the appointment, including directions, parking instructions, and any intake paperwork the Practice requires.
- A post-visit follow-up (when applicable) confirming the visit and providing aftercare instructions.
Patients will not receive marketing, promotional, or third-party content via SMS through IvoryStack. Communication is limited to the purposes above and is initiated by appointment events in the Practice’s scheduling system.
Message frequency
Typical patients receive 1–4 messages per appointment. Patients who have multiple upcoming appointments may receive more. Patients are never enrolled in recurring messaging campaigns; every message is tied to a specific appointment event.
How patients opt out
Patients may opt out of SMS communication at any time by:
- Replying STOP to any IvoryStack message. The opt-out is processed immediately and applies across all message types.
- Replying HELP for assistance, which returns the Practice’s contact phone number.
- Contacting the Practice directly to update their communication preferences.
To resume messages after opting out, patients can reply START to the same number or re-consent during their next appointment booking.

Privacy and HIPAA
SMS communication is governed by IvoryStack’s Privacy Policy and applicable laws, including the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A). Patient phone numbers and message content are:
- Stored encrypted at rest
- Transmitted only to the Practice that initiated the message and to our SMS delivery partner (Twilio Inc., subject to a Business Associate Agreement)
- Never sold, rented, or shared with third parties for marketing
- Retained only as long as required to fulfill the appointment-related purpose and any applicable record-keeping obligation
IvoryStack does not transmit detailed health information via SMS. Messages contain only the patient’s first name, appointment time and location, provider name, and a link to a personalized video hosted on IvoryStack infrastructure.
